我通过python获取了一些JSON数据,并且我得到了一本字典。数据被转义,所以我有一个字符串:
https:\\/\\/pbs.twimg.com\\/profile_banners\\/2604140473\\/1404508267
不幸的是,按照解码"".decode("string-escape")
的方法不起作用,也没有使用底码,或者使用字符串,unicode ...我不知道它应该如何,我只是试过我在这里找到了什么。如果我对其进行编码,则返回以下内容:
'https:\\\\/\\\\/pbs.twimg.com\\\\/profile_banners\\\\/2604140473\\\\/1404508267'
如果数据已经解码并被视为文字字符串而不是转义字符串,那就好了。
我该怎么做才能解决这个问题?
答案 0 :(得分:2)
可以像以下一样简单:
>>> tgt
'https:\\/\\/pbs.twimg.com\\/profile_banners\\/2604140473\\/1404508267'
>>> tgt.replace('\\', '')
'https://pbs.twimg.com/profile_banners/2604140473/1404508267'